Ravi Teja's brother arrested Madapur police arrested Bhupathi Bharat Raju, brother of Tollywood actor Ravi Teja, for allegedly creating nuisance under the influence of alcohol on Monday night and also misbehaving with police personnel.
According to Madapur chief inspector Narasimhulu, the accused Bhupathi Bharat Raju, a resident of Kavuri Hills, parked his car in the middle of the road in front of his house at 12.30 pm and was talking to a woman while consuming liquor.
When beat constables asked the accused to move his car, he allegedly misbehaved with the cops and abused them. On receipt of the information, Madapur sub inspector Rajasekhar, along with a posse of police constables rushed to the spot, arrested the accused and whisked him away to the police station.
Police also seized Raju's car and registered a case under Section 353 IPC (assault or criminal force to deter public servant from discharge of his duty). He was produced in the Miyapur court on Tuesday morning. The court granted him bail on furnishing surety of Rs 5,000 and a personal bond.
